search

組合語言暫存器儲存器問題

組合語言暫存器儲存器問題

  1、儲存器是用來儲存微型計算機工作時使用的資訊的部件,正是因為有了儲存器,計算機才有資訊記憶功能。儲存器在CPU外,一般指硬碟,隨身碟等可以在切斷電源後儲存資料的裝置,容量一般比較大,缺點是讀寫速度都很慢,普通的機械硬碟讀寫速度一般是每秒50MB左右;

  2、暫存器是CPU內部的元件,所以在暫存器之間的資料傳送非常快。暫存器可將暫存器內的資料執行算術及邏輯運算,存於暫存器內的地址可用來指向記憶體的某個位置,即定址。也可以用來讀寫資料到電腦的周邊裝置。

組合語言暫存器都叫什麼

  AX:累加暫存器。BX:基址暫存器。CX:計數暫存器。DX:資料暫存器。SP:堆疊指標暫存器。BP:基址指標暫存器。SI:源變址暫存器。DI:目的變址暫存器。IP:指令指標暫存器。CS:程式碼段暫存器。DS:資料段暫存器。SS:堆疊段暫存器。ES:附加段暫存器 。OF:溢位標誌,運算元超出機器能表示的範圍表示溢位,溢位時為1。SF:符號標誌記錄運算結果的符號,結果負時為1。ZF:零標誌運算結果等於0時為1,否則為0。CF:進位標誌,最高有效位產生進位時為1,否則為0。AF:輔助進位標誌,運算時第3位向第4位產生進位時為1,否則為0。PF:奇偶標誌,運算結果運算元位為1的個數為偶數個時為1,否則為0。

儲存器和暫存器區別

  儲存器和暫存器的區別是:

  1、儲存器功能:存放指令和資料,並能由中央處理器(CPU)直接隨機存取。

  2、暫存器功能:可將暫存器內的資料執行算術及邏輯運算;存於暫存器內的地址可用來指向記憶體的某個位置,即定址;可以用來讀寫資料到電腦的周邊裝置。

  3、暫存器的速度比主儲存器的速度要快很多,由於暫存器的容量有限,所以將不需要操作的資料存放在主儲存器中,主儲存器中的資料必須放入暫存器材能夠進行操作。

  4、簡單地說:暫存器是操作資料的地方,儲存器是存放資料的地方。

  5、暫存器一般是指由基本的RS觸發器結構衍生出來的D觸發,就是一些與非門構成的結構,一般整合在CPU內,其讀寫速度跟CPU的執行速度基本匹配,但因為效能優越,所以造價昂貴,一般好的CPU也就只有幾MB的級快取,級快取更小。

  6、儲存器在CPU外,一般指硬碟,隨身碟等可以在切斷電源後儲存資料的裝置,容量一般比較大,缺點是讀寫速度都很慢,普通的機械硬碟讀寫速度一般是MB/S左右。記憶體和暫存器就是為了解決儲存器讀寫速度慢而產生的多級儲存機制。


dptr是什麼作用是什麼

  DPTR的作用是存放16位地址,作為片外RAM定址用的地址暫存器(間接定址),故稱資料指標,也可以將外部RAM中地址的傳送到部RAM的地址所指向的內容中。DPTR的另一個作用是變址定址,訪問程式儲存器,做查表指令。   DPTR是某些微控制器中一個功能比較特殊的暫存器,是一個16位的特殊功能暫存器。DPT ...

彙編中為什麼要初始化

  不僅是彙編,C語言也是要初始化暫存器的。而且不管是什麼樣的CPU做成的系統,只要沒有作業系統支援,都要初始化暫存器的。作業系統的啟動階段也要初始化暫存器的。初始化暫存器的目的是為系統的執行設定合適的、確定的、已知的初始狀態。   彙編大多是指組合語言,彙編程式。把組合語言翻譯成機器語言的過程稱為彙編。在組 ...

組合語言中SP是什麼

  1、組合語言中SP是堆疊暫存器。堆疊是一段按照後進先出原則組織起來的連續儲存區域。用於程式儲存或恢復資料,或用於子程式呼叫及中斷響應時保護與恢復現場。SP是堆疊指標暫存器,存放著當前堆疊棧頂地址;   2、一般情況下,對SP有影響的指令,對SP的操作都是隱式,即SP並不出現在指令運算元當中。要注意進出棧的 ...

標誌的作用

  用來判斷CPU的狀態。標誌暫存器又稱程式狀態字(外語縮寫:PSW、外語全稱:Program Status Word)。這是一個16位的存放條件標誌、控制標誌暫存器,主要用於反映處理器的狀態和ALU運算結果的某些特徵及控制指令的執行。   進位標誌:用於反映運算是否產生進位或借位。如果運算結果的最高位產生一 ...

記憶體與通用的區別

  記憶體:記憶體是計算機中重要的部件之一,它是與CPU進行溝通的橋樑。計算機中所有程式的執行都是在記憶體中進行的,因此記憶體的效能對計算機的影響非常大。記憶體也被稱為記憶體儲器,其作用是用於暫時存放CPU中的運算資料,以及與硬碟等外部儲存器交換的資料。只要計算機在執行中,CPU就會把需要運算的資料調到記憶體 ...

指令的作用

  指令暫存器IR(InstructionRegister),是臨時放置從記憶體裡面取得的程式指令的暫存器。   指令暫存器(IR,InstructionRegister)。存放當前從主儲存器讀出的正在執行的一條指令。當執行一條指令時,先把它從記憶體取到資料暫存器(DR,DataRegister)中,然後再傳 ...

原理

  1、暫存器原理 :暫存器的基本單元是 D觸發器,按照其用途分為基本暫存器和移位暫存器。基本暫存器是由 D觸發器組成,在 CP 脈衝作用下,每個 D觸發器能夠寄存一位二進位制碼。在 D=0 時,暫存器儲存為 0,在 D=1 時,暫存器儲存為 1。   2、在低電平為 0、高電平為 1 時,需將訊號源與 D ...